Jose Antonio Vargas, sometimes called “America’s Most Famous Undocumented Immigrant,” was detained by border patrol in McAllen, Texas today while attempting to fly home after a border vigil for the Central American children fleeing violence.

Jose, who is a Pultizer Prize winning Journalist and recently released a biographical documentary called “Undocumented,”  joined UWD and MAC (Minority Affairs Council), a UWD affiliate, in McAllen, Texas this past weekend to uplift the stories of refugees fleeing persecution in Central America.
But Jose was unaware that McAllen in South Texas is completely surrounded by U.S. Border Patrol checkpoints. Tania Chavez of the Minority Affairs Council in McAllen, Texas said in an email to advocates today:
Jose’s current situation is our reality every day. For many undocumented immigrants who live near the border, we can’t return to our home countries, and can’t travel outside of a 100-mile radius in our home state of Texas. We’re trapped inside a cage.

Early this morning United We DREAM and other advocates marched to the airport to stand with Jose and families who live on the border.
